Newton College of the Sacred Heart

Newton College of the Sacred Heart was a small women's liberal arts college in , . Founded in 1946 by the Society of the Sacred Heart, Newton College remained an independent, all-girls institution until beginning its merger with Boston College on June 28, 1974.
